πŸ—ΊοΈ The Route

The complete Lake Garda circuit covers approximately 140km starting from Toscolano-Maderno, following the lakefront roads through SalΓ², Gardone Riviera, Limone sul Garda, Riva del Garda, Malcesine, Bardolino, and Peschiera del Garda before returning. The digital guide app provides turn-by-turn navigation and audio content about each lakeside town and viewpoint. The western shore road between Gargnano and Limone offers dramatic cliff-hugging curves with the lake stretching 51km below, framed by the Dolomites to the north. This route follows ancient Roman roads that connected the Alpine passes to the Venetian plains, making Lake Garda a strategic crossroads for over 2,000 years.

πŸ’‘ Insider Tip

The northern section between Riva del Garda and Malcesine has the steepest gradients and narrowest roads β€” plan this section for mid-morning when traffic is lighter and before afternoon winds pick up on the lake.
